- Summary
- · To Mr. Harding : 1 autograph letter third person : 4 May [ca. 1802-1818] : (MISC 2006) : noting enclosed payment of a bill, likely for a Queen Charlotte-related purchase. In William Upcott's album of letters by eminent women.

- Biography (note)
- Charlotte Beckedorff, employed as Keeper of the Robes for Queen Charlotte from 1802 until the Queen's death in 1818. From 1796-1792, Fanny Burney had held the position of Second Keeper of the Robes for Queen Charlotte.
